29.09.2025 20:01 β π 65 π 34 π¬ 20 π 7One perfect dark red Macoun apple hanging on a tree
Apple season in New England! My favorite is the Macoun, bred by New York researchers in the 1920s from MacIntosh and Jersey Black stock. Great in pies and greater eaten fresh, crispy and tart (but not too tart).
They don't keep super well, so there's many a pie in our near future.
